Tharja is both almost identical to Sariya in pronunciation and an absolutely valid translation of her name. It's not even really "localized." You can entirely get the Th- thing out of サーリャ, provided you're looking at it as an English speaker. Also NoJ romanized it "Sallya," so I'd say we dodged a bullet there. Localization would be something like Velvet -> Panne, and I can understand objecting to that, but overall I think most of the translated names we got are pretty well-chosen. We'll have to get used to them of course. Just like we got used to Ike over Aiku, because I mean come on.

Seliph is certainly unusual though. I just want to know if they made the right call on his half-siblings. But yeah, it's better than Serlis, which just sounds like mangled translation. Regy Rusty posted:

What kind of games are the Shin Megami Tensei games? I know nothing about them.

RPGs of various flavors. The main series is mostly dungeon crawlers, Digital Devil Saga is a more of a straight RPG, Devil Survivor is an SRPG, the modern Personas are half RPG/half dating sim, etc. More likely than not this is going to be very similar to the Devil Survivor series, seeing as FE is an SRPG itself.
